    IFF executive committee (heyat raiseh) usually has 9 members. They need 8 members according to their own rules for any formal meetings to take place.
    Since Shohreh Mousavi is under arrest (financial stuff unrelated to IFF), and Azizi Khadem doesn't show up, they can't hold a formal meeting.

  • teammelli91
    replied
    taremiscores O-ZoNe and Nokhodi, you all make valid points.

    Yes, we did play against those teams and I think they did help us prepare for the World Cup. Maybe more so versus Morocco, as we played Tunisia and Algeria (great friendlies to prepare vs. Morocco). Even though we didn't prepare as well versus Spain and Portugal, the preparation process was a lot better than the preparation for 2014 WC.

    CQ was one of our, if not the best manager we've had in our history. And although I'm a fan of CQ, he had many flaws. I criticized him for some of his tactical decisions. Sometimes I thought it was annoying how he would just storm out of interviews and how he acted. However, I can't deny him fighting for his team and for his players.

    People shit on CQ but what they forget is that he wasn't licking majles's nutsack. CQ's efforts helped get many of these friendlies. He played a role in PEC facility becoming a reality (that fitness building you see in TM videos that looks kind of like a museum for TM. With framed photos of our legends nailed to the walls and etc.). He was unrelentingly pushing IFF staff to help Team Melli. IFF were pushing majles and the other weirdos with the branded foreheads, to get financial help for our preparation. He pushed them so hard to the point where Mehdi Taj got a heart attack. Which is sad.

    My point is, I respect and support Dragon for what he's done so far. I want to believe he will push IFF to get us even Turkey and Algeria again. But something tells me that won't be the case. I hope I'm wrong, I really do. But when I read things like "We will beat England" knowing that we don't even know yet what's planned in June, I'm not sure what to think. It reminds me of 2006 and song lyrics of "Portugal is Portoghaal" and etc. These aren't happy memories.

    I hope I'm wrong and IFF help arrange good friendlies for us. Our team deserves only the best! Our fans deserve only the best!
